Source: U.S. Census Bureau ACS (2023)Sandy Oaks, TX has a population of 5,227 with a median age of 43.4. The racial makeup is 41.1% White, 75.3% Hispanic, 1.0% Black, 1.1% Asian. About 7.8%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The foreign-born population is 16.9%.
